This is one of two commissioned pieces. My client requested a height chart for marking the growth of their daughter who is two years old. The chart is 10"x85" and is made of 100% cotton fabrics.
I have incorporated into the chart, a frame to hold a wallet size photograph of the little girl each year through her 18th birthday.
The piece is hand quilted and hand bound. Quilted inside each frame is the corresponding year for her age as she grows. The first frame on the bottom has a zero in it and is for her first picture taken the day she was born.
Her name is handquilted down the side and a frog, ladybug, sun, tree, building blocks with her initials and flowers are hand quilted on the chart.
Each year on her birthday she will be measured and the date and a mark will be made on the chart side with a permanent fabric marker. Detail Photo

This is the second of two commissioned charts. My client requested a height chart for marking the growth of their second child, a son. The chart is 10"x85" and is made of 100% cotton fabrics.
I have incorporated into the chart, a frame to hold a wallet size photograph of the little boy each year through his 18th birthday.
The piece is hand quilted and hand bound. Quilted inside each frame is the corresponding year for his age as he grows. The first frame on the bottom has a zero in it and is for his first picture taken the day he was born.
His name is handquilted down the side, and frogs, bugs, turtles, pine trees, basketballs, footballs and soccer balls are hand quilted on the chart.
At the top is hand quilted a classic car from the early 1970s and at the bottom is a pair of praying hands as well as a heart with a cross inside.
Each year on his birthday he will be measured. The date and a mark will be made on the chart side with a permanent fabric marker.

This one-of-a-kind Roman Shade was commissioned for a house remodel project. It is made with 12 different blue fabrics and six browns.
The "quilt" is not hand quilted as my other pieces are, but machine stitched only where the staves are for raising and lowering the shade. The shade has no batting, just a piece of unbleached muslin on the back side. It is signed and dated by the artist. The shade is 86 3/4" x 95" and is in two seperate panels so that only one can be open at a time or both.

This piece is part of a series of "charm" quilts. This piece reflects on the Spring season. It measures 15 1/2" x 18 3/4".
73 different fabrics are used in this piece. Yellows, light blues, medium and light greens. No two fabrics are repeated in the center area of the piece. Each rectangle in the center is hand quilted around each piece.
The piece is hand quilted and hand bound. A vine with leaves on one edge is hand quilted in the first border and a circle chain is quilted in the mint green leaf print final border. It is bound with the same light green fabric used in the first border. Detail Photo

This piece is part of a series of "charm" quilts. This piece reflects on the Summer season when all the grass and leaves are at their deepest green color. It measures 15 1/2" x 18 3/4".
126 different fabrics are used in this piece. eight whites, ten tans, 32 blues and 48 greens make up the center of the piece. 28 blacks were joined end to end to make the frame around the center.
No two fabrics are repeated in the entire piece. A rectangle shape is hand quilted at intervals from the center of the quilt, out.
The piece is hand quilted and hand bound. A grey binding is used to finish the piece. Detail Photo
